Aluminum Frame for Vertical Engine Spec: Honda Monkey Custom

Monkey Custom by G-craft

Honda has many classic models, one of the most unforgettable is the Minimoto "Monkey". With a small and exquisite body, ultra-low fuel consumption, the Monkey has been popular for more than half a century, but also let more people understand what "Big fun in the small body" means when riding a mini bike.

As for the origin of the name "Monkey," Honda's official website explains that it was named after the image of a cute little leisure bike, but another theory is that the rider on the Monkey resembles a monkey. Engine

A vertical engine for Ape and XR series on this Monkey. Honda's minimoto engines include the horizontal engine used in the Monkey and Cub, and the vertical engine used in the Ape.(Although the stock Cub and Monkey are equipped with the same type of horizontal engine, they have different settings.)

In general, vertical engines can utilize the weight of the piston and connecting rods (the universal gravitational force that causes objects to fall to the ground), which allows the crankshaft to move smoothly and easily generate power. People say minimotos are positioned as sports models with an emphasis on riding for those with vertical engines, and as practical models with an emphasis on fuel economy and convenience for those with horizontal engines, or as leisure models with an emphasis on fun.

Chassis

In order for this engine to fit in, a special frame is needed. G-craft developed the GC-018 frame that was a new challenge for them. It is a unique frame that can accommodate the vertical engine of the Ape and XR series, while the exterior can be used for a Monkey. A unique shape, the main pipe is made of 7N01 aluminum, and the seat rail is made of machined blocks.

The frame is compatible with 10-inch wide wheels front and rear. 3.5J front and 5.5J rear, and both the stem kit and swingarms are designed to be used with the Monkey.

It is a new style that goes beyond the boundaries of a leisure bike and becomes more like a "motorcycle".

Body

When talking about customization of the Monkey, customization itself is not complete without the seat and exterior parts. G-craft used a stepped tuck-roll seat on this model. This kind of custom seat is designed for comfort and appearance, and the optimal urethane sponge to avoid buttocks pain even after riding for a long time.

The tank is stock. I prefer this style without fancy painting works, simple but performance. This is a complete custom machine for the challengers who wants to create a vehicle that cannot be seen anywhere else.

Specifications

Part Details
Engine Ape100
Exhaust Custom by Over Racing
Frame G-craft GC-018
Swingarm G-craft Monkey Wide Swingarm T/S +10cm
Stem G-craft Stem Kit Multi Type 2 For Φ30 Fork
Step G-craft Rearset Drum for Monkey(stock look)
Front fork G-craft NSR Mini Front Fork
Rear shock GAZY
Tank Stock
Wheels Front: G-craft 10-inches 3.5J Wheel 1-wheel
Rear: G-craft 10-inches 5.5J Wheel 1-wheel (Up to 4.0J for GC-018 frame)
Brake Front: 6POT Caliper
Rear: Stock
Seat G-craft Custom Seat Stepped Tuck Roll(Improved product)
Others G-craft CR Mini Φ22 Air Filter Adapter
G-craft Φ30 Light Bracket(Renewal of Part No.32102)
G-craft Adjustable Stand Holder
G-craft Aluminum Adjustment Stand
Battery Case(Attached to the frame)
